Saturday 1st June 2024
Saturday the 1st June heralded the arrival of the great British ‘Summer’ and with it, the Bale Fete 2024. With the weather being decidedly non-summer-like leading up to the fete, the day itself stayed dry, if blowy, so the weather gods were kind to us.
Thank you once again to Walter for all his hard work and for hosting the fete in his beautiful gardens. A better
venue would be hard to find.
The excellent Cromer & Sheringham brass band were yet again on hand to provide the quintessential soundtrack to a British summer fete, with plenty of ‘oomph-pa-pa.
Attendance was good and the tea, cake, sandwiches, strawberries and produce stalls were a huge hit…
strategically placed as they were to entice visitors on arrival.
I must admit I did partake of a flapjack, and it was delicious indeed.
Over on the tombola stall, Sarah and I were overwhelmed by the amount of people that came over to have a go. By the end of the day, not a solitary prize was left on the table. This was mainly the result of children having close access to Granny, Mum or Dad’s money, to feed their dedication/addiction to bagging those stupendous prizes.
